In plain words

On 31 January 2019, Hill's Science Diet recalled Canned Dog Food. US FDA gives the reason as: Potentially Elevated Levels of Vitamin D

If you have this product, stop feeding it and keep the packaging and the receipt. If your pet is unwell, call your vet. This page is what US FDA published and when it changed; it is not advice.
